Transaction 580896151184e21f0e17aba31430a5659a83dec384a800ff47094252d68efd69

1 Input
2 Outputs
  • 580896151184e21f0e17aba31430a5659a83dec384a800ff47094252d68efd69:0
  • value  140100
    address  2MvvhNZJhNP3pJkypDWYb13hDrMmeFuuKp1
  • 580896151184e21f0e17aba31430a5659a83dec384a800ff47094252d68efd69:1
  • value  139927
    address  2N3v4h4JuXnULDsPZoQR2Nc4YukARwMfNaB